Output 07d8dcbed5a46cd54e02e7b5d724a23e4997479c3870d60ff9a1fd70ee46b1a7:89

value
349945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98a348f5d234baf900f6cd427ff65847db01935a OP_EQUAL
address
3Fc6Ewdd7sCAqwRSwHkxBF61EYNCii165o
transaction
07d8dcbed5a46cd54e02e7b5d724a23e4997479c3870d60ff9a1fd70ee46b1a7
spent
true